#b1c7da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b1c7da is composed of 69.4% red, 78% green and 85.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 18.8% cyan, 8.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 207.8 degrees, a saturation of 35.7% and a lightness of 77.5%. #b1c7da color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#638fb5. Closest websafe color is: #99cccc.

#b1c7da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b1c7da has RGB values of R:177, G:199, B:218 and CMYK values of C:0.19, M:0.09, Y:0,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 11651034.
